[00:00.49]'Do you call that a hat?' I said to my wife.
[00:05.83]'You needn't be so rude about it,' my wife answered as she looked at herself in the mirror.
[00:12.43]I sat down on one of those modern chairs with holes in it and waited.
[00:18.19]We had been in the hat shop for half an hour and my wife was still in front of the mirror.
[00:25.20]'We mustn't buy things we don't need,' I remarked suddenly. I regretted saying it almost at once.
[00:33.77]'You needn't have said that,' my wife answered.
[00:37.98]I needn't remind you of that terrible tie you bought yesterday.
[00:44.27]'I find it beautiful,' I said. 'A man can never have too many ties.'
[00:51.16]'And a woman can't have too many hats,' she answered.
[00:55.77]Ten minutes later we walked out of the shop together.
[00:59.86]My wife was wearing a hat that looked like a lighthouse!
